Recombinant Human CGA, Fc-tagged

Cat.No. : CGA-285H
Product Overview : A DNA sequence encoding the human CGA (NP_000726.1) (Met1-Ser116) was expressed with the Fc region of mouse IgG1 at the C-terminus.

Source : Human Cells
Species : Human
Tag : Fc
Form : Lyophilized from sterile PBS, pH7.4.
Molecular Mass : The recombinant human CGA/mFc comprises 326 amino acids and has a predicted molecular mass of 36.6 kDa. The apparent molecular mass of the protein is approximately 45.8 kDa in SDS-PAGE under reducing conditions.
Protein length : Met1-Ser116
Endotoxin : < 1.0 eu per μg of the protein as determined by the LAL method.
Purity : >90 % as determined by SDS-PAGE
Stability : Samples are stable for up to twelve months from date of receipt at -70℃
Storage : Store it under sterile conditions at -70℃. It is recommended that the protein be aliquoted for optimal storage. Av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les.
